In June we were told that there was little chance that a referral would be received for us by the September 1 deadline. So after almost 2 ½ years we were faced with what we thought was the end of a road for us. Not the end of “the” road, but “a” road. We packed away the baby things that we had been collecting (we even gave some away). We planned a vacation and to put our house on the market (we want to move over to the West Shore where 90% of our lives are.)
Well the vacation was a blast. Lilli, Kristi and I had a great time with Mickey and the gang in Orlando. The house was just about ready. In fact we had just arranged with the realtor to put the sign out on Monday. Then this morning happens.

At 11:00 AM we got a call from our social worker at the agency to let us know that we had a referral. WHAT?! You’ve got to be kidding. Sure enough within minutes we had an email with pictures and information on a precious little girl and a child acceptance form that had to completed and faxed and FedEx’d back today (remember September 1 is Monday.) We had a baby.

Nguyen Xuan Lan (to be named Katelin Lan Foster) was born on June 15 of this year, and currently in Vietnam. We will be traveling to Vietnam in November or December to bring her home.

I guess we hadn’t really gotten to the end of the road. We had gotten to a “T” intersection, and all we had to do was look left and right, and see that the road still continued. And that in time, there on the horizon, we would with God’s guidance, get to our destination.
